Job Description:

The Spa Director is responsible for the overall coordination and execution of spa activities in accordance with the Wind Creek Hospitality Purpose, Values, and Expectations Guide. The Spa Director supervises and assures delivery of an exceptional spa experience to guests. The Spa Director inspires staff to deliver five-diamond guest service at all times. The Spa Director provides sincere service to guests and co-workers through actions that display self-confidence, grace and courtesy. The Spa Director is responsible for assuring that departmental objectives are attained.

Job Responsibility:

  • Develops a plan to reorganize, re-launch, and operate a life-style wellness centered spa operation
  • Develops and meets operating objectives and budgets
  • Develops and implements a marketing and sales strategy that will deliver a constant message centered around “an escape from the ordinary” and increase visits
  • Leads the facility staff to deliver customers an escape from their ordinary world and assure that the outcome of every visit results in a feeling of belonging and importance for the customer
  • Develops, maintains, and consistently re-invents a menu of healthy-lifestyle driven wellness programs or variable time lengths that incorporate spa services, culinary instruction, and other programs that can be accommodated by on-staff or consulting instructors
  • Oversees a dedicated marketing and sales program that is concentrated in key markets and actively participates in resort wide marketing endeavors to stimulate consumer awareness and sales bookings
  • Maximize retail revenue by offering a strong and diverse line of spa and culinary merchandise
  • Perform monthly inventories and ensure sufficient inventories are maintained to meet operational needs
  • Develops and maintains standard operating procedures for facility operations
  • Recruits, hires, trains and retains an effective and professional staff
  • Actively coaches, mentors and develops team members
  • Produces or oversees evaluations for staff
  • Monitors departmental service levels and assures that standards are met and customer feedback is exceptional
  • Anticipates, identifies and ensures that guest needs are being met in the best possible way
  • Keeps staff informed and knowledgeable of pertinent information
  • Conducts daily pre-shift meetings and departmental staff meetings as required
  • Generates spa & cooking studio forecasts – weekly, monthly, quarterly and annually and interprets, analyzes and reports on the Spa’s financial performance
  • Manages labor and operating expenses in accordance to business levels
  • Manages inventory
  • follow purchasing guidelines
  • Ensures compliance with purchasing procedures
  • Ensures that accidents and claims are minimized by having staff focused on safety
  • Ensures that staff is trained on safety and emergency procedures
  • Other duties and responsibilities as assigned

Requirements:

  • High School diploma or GED
  • Bachelor’s Degree in Related Field AND three (3) years’ experience in a Spa Management position
  • OR Seven (7) years’ experience in a Spa Management position
  • OR Five (5) years’ experience in a Spa Management position with Wind Creek Hospitality
  • Five (5) years of work experience in a 4-diamond caliber destination spa as a Manager or Assistant Manager
  • Must be proficient in Microsoft Office applications - Outlook, Word, Excel, PowerPoint (skills test may be administered)
  • Demonstrated executive level writing and verbal communication skills required (skills test may be administered)
  • Demonstrated prior experience in development of marketing and promotional programs that resulted in measurable positive financial and other outcomes for the company
  • Demonstrated prior experience as a senior manager in opening a destination spa
  • Willing to work odd and irregular hours including nights, weekends, and holidays
  • Willing to travel and participate in training as recommended or required
  • Must have a valid and current State Driver’s License and an insurable driving record for purposes of driving company vehicles as required
  • Must have an Occupational License (or the ability to obtain and maintain a license) pursuant to the Illinois Gaming Act and remain in good standing with the Illinois Gaming Board as a requirement for this position
